Music icons Sting and Eminem will headline the post-race concerts at 2024’s Formula One Grand Prix at the Circuit of the Americas. Sting will perform timeless hits from his catalog on Friday night and Eminem, who is celebrating the 25th anniversary of his album “The Slim Shady LP” with the release of a new record, “The Death of Slim Shady (Coup de Grace),” will take the mainstage on Saturday. The Formula One Grand Prix takes place on October 18-20. Entrance to the concerts is included with your race ticket. Tickets and more information at circuitoftheamericas.com. Big Sean nearly bridged a gap in Detroit hip hop history by bringing together two Detroit legends: Eminem and J Dilla. Sean rapped on two J Dilla beats and even had an unreleased Dilla beat planned for his album “Detroit 2”. What is even more intriguing is that this beat was originally envisioned as a collaboration with Eminem. Sean described the beat to Essence magazine: “It reminded me of an old Eminem”.
